Planowanie projektu i analiza wymagań.
Uspęšne stworzenie witryny internetowej zaczyna się od jasnego planowania projektu. Cel tego etapu jest określenie celu witryny, grupy odbiorców oraz jej kluczowych funkcji, co stanowi podstawę dla dalszych prac.
Wyznaczenie jasnych celów i określenie pozycji na rynku
Najważniejszym zadaniem jest odpowiedzenie na kilka podstawowych pytań: Czy witryna internetowa służy do promocji marki, sprzedaży w formie e-commerce, publikacji treści czy świadczenia usług online? Kto jest jej odbiorcą? Jakie celowe wyniki biznesowe chcemy osiągnąć dzięki tej witrynie – np. zwiększenie rozpoznawalności marki, generowanie leadów lub bezpośrednie realizowanie transakcji? Odpowiedzi na te pytania bezpośrednio wpłyną na wybór technologii i projektowanie funkcji witryny.
Strategia treści i lista funkcji
Na podstawie celów i strategii pozycjonowania konieczne jest przygotowanie dokładnej strategii treści oraz listy wymagań funkcjonalnych. Strategia treści obejmuje typy stron, które muszą znajdować się na stronie internetowej (np. strona główna, „O nas”, „Produkty/usługi”, blog, strona kontaktów), a także informacje, które powinny być na tych stronach zawarte. Lista wymagań funkcjonalnych zawiera wszystkie niezbędne elementy interakcji, takie jak formularze kontaktowe, systemy rejestracji i logowania użytkowników, funkcja wyszukiwania, koszyki zakupów, integracja z platformami płatności itd. Dokładny dokument z wymaganiami pomaga uniknąć rozszerzania zakresu prac w późniejszym etapie realizacji projektu.
Polecamy lekturę. Przewodnik po całym procesie tworzenia witryny internetowej: praktyki i strategie techniczne od zera do uruchomienia.。
Kryteria wyboru technologii
W fazie planowania konieczne jest wcześniejsze rozpatrzenie wyboru technologii, co wymaga pogodzenia między efektywnością rozwoju, wydajnością, kosztami oraz łatwością utrzymania w przyszłości. W przypadku prostych stron prezentujących treści można zastosować… WordPress Systemy zarządzania treścią (CMS) mogą być bardziej wydajne; natomiast w przypadku złożonych aplikacji wymagających wysokiej stopniu personalizacji interfejsu użytkownika, można zdecydować się na inne rozwiązania. React、Vue.js W połączeniu z front-endowymi frameworkami… Node.js、Python Django 或 PHP Laravel Wiąże się to z potrzebą wdrożenia odpowiednich technologii na stronie serwerowej. Ponadto należy uwzględnić środowisko hostingu oraz bazy danych (np.…) MySQL、PostgreSQL、MongoDBIntegracja z usługami third-party oraz API.
Przygotowanie projektu i treści
Po zakończeniu etapu planowania projekt przechodzi do fazy tworzenia wizualnego wyglądu i zawartości. Projektowanie dotyczy nie tylko estetyki, ale także doświadczenia użytkownika (UX – User Experience) i interfejsu użytkownika (UI – User Interface).
Architektura informacji a projektowanie prototypów.
Architektura informacyjna ma na celu racjonalne zorganizowanie treści witryny internetowej, aby była intuicyjna i łatwa w używaniu przez użytkowników. Zwykle do przedstawienia wszystkich stron oraz ich wzajemnych relacji tworzy się mapa witryny. Następnie, za pomocą narzędzi do tworzenia prototypów w formie linii (wireframe diagrams), przygotowuje się prototypy w niskiej rozdzielczości, które pokazują rozkład elementów na poszczególnych stronach, bez uwzględniania detali wzornika wizualnego; istotne jest tu ustalenie priorytetów funkcji i treści.
Styl wizualny i projektowanie interfejsu użytkownika (UI)
Na podstawie prototypu designer UI przygotuje wizualny projekt, określając kolorystykę, fonty, ikony, styl кнопek oraz inne elementy wyglądu witryny, a także stworzy wysokiej jakości projekt graficzny. W tym etapie konieczne jest uzyskanie pewności, że styl projektu jest zgodny z identyfikacją marki (brand image) oraz że są stosowane podstawowe zasady użyteczności (usability principles). Współczesnym standardem jest projektowanie responsywne, co oznacza, że projekt musi uwzględniać wygląd witryny na różnych rozmiarach ekranów – na komputerze, tablecie i smartfonie.
Gromadzenie i tworzenie treści
“Treść jest kluczowa” – wysokiej jakości treść to klucz do przyciągania i utrzymywania użytkowników. W tym etapie należy tworzyć lub integrować wszystkie niezbędne teksty zgodnie z przyjętą strategią treści, wliczając informacje o firmie, opisy produktów, artykuły na blogu itd. Ponadto konieczne jest przygotowanie lub stworzenie wysokiej jakości zdjęć, nagrań wideo, ikon oraz innych materiałów multimedialnych. Wszystkie elementy treści muszą zostać wcześniej przygotowane, sprawdzone i optymalizowane, aby mogły zostać bezpośrednio wdrożone na stronę internetową.
Polecamy lekturę. Analiza całego procesu budowy stron internetowych w czasach współczesnych: od zera do stworzenia profesjonalnej platformy online。
Etapy rozwoju i testowania
Rozwoj to proces przekształcenia projektu w rzeczywisty, działający website, który zwykle składa się z dwóch części: rozwoju front-endu i rozwoju back-endu.
Implementacja na stronie frontowej ( frontend development)
Wykorzystywane przez programistów front-end. HTML、CSS 和 JavaScript Konwertuj projekt graficzny interfejsu użytkownika (UI) w stronę internetową, którą można interaktywnie używać w przeglądarcu. Twórcy zajmą się tworzeniem responsywnego rozkładu, aby strona dobrze wyglądała na różnych urządzeniach. Programiści będą stosować zasadę modularności, np. wykorzystując dostępne komponenty. React Komponenty lub… Vue Aby stworzyć moduły interfejsu wielokrotnie używalne, można skorzystać z komponentów jednego pliku. Podstawowym punktem tego etapu jest optymalizacja wydajności, w tym z opóźnionego ładowania zdjęć, rozdzielania kodu (Code Splitting itd.). HTML Struktura jest kluczowa dla efektywności SEO, dlatego należy upewnić się o poprawnym użyciu semantycznych tagów.
<!-- 一个语义化的文章摘要结构示例 -->
<article class="post-preview">
<header>
<h2><a href="/pl/blog/post-url/">Tytuł artykułu</a></h2>
<p class="meta">Opublikowano: <time datetime="2026-03-27">27 marca 2026 roku</time></p>
</header>
<div class="excerpt">
<p>Oto streszczenie artykułu….</p>
</div>
<footer>
<a href="/pl/blog/post-url/" class="read-more">Czytaj dalej.</a>
</footer>
</article> Rozwój backendu i bazy danych
Programiści obsługujący backend są odpowiedzialni za budowę “umysłu” i “pamięci” witryny internetowej. Korzystają z języków programowania używanych na stronie serwera (np.…) PHP、Python、JavaScript (Node.js)Tworzy się logika aplikacji, obsługuje wysyłanie formularzy, zarządza sesjami użytkowników oraz interaguje z bazą danych. Na przykład funkcja w języku PHP, która zajmuje się procesem logowania użytkowników, może mieć taką nazwę: authenticateUser()Budują strukturę tabel w bazach danych oraz piszą zapytania do ich obsługi, aby przechowywać i wyszukiwać informacje, a także zapewniają bezpieczeństwo i integralność tych danych.
Wszestoronne testy i iteracje
Po zakończeniu budowy podstawowych funkcji witryny konieczne jest przeprowadzenie dokładnych testów. Testy obejmują:
1. Test funkcjonalny: upewnij się, że wszystkie linki, formularze, przyciski i funkcje interaktywne działają tak, jak powinny.
2. Testy zgodności: sprawdź, czy wygląd i funkcje są spójne na różnych przeglądarkach (Chrome, Firefox, Safari, Edge) oraz na różnych urządzeniach.
3. Testy wydajności: Korzystaj z narzędzi takich jak Google PageSpeed Insights lub Lighthouse, aby przeanalizować czas ładowania strony i zoptymalizować obrazy, skrypty oraz pliki CSS.
4. Testy bezpieczeństwa: sprawdzenie typowych luk w zabezpieczeniu, takich jak inwazje typu SQL injection oraz ataki typu cross-site scripting (XSS).
Problem wykryty podczas testów (błąd) musi zostać zarejestrowany i naprawiony; ten proces często wymaga kilku iteracji.
Rozwój i późniejsze utrzymanie systemu
Gdy witryna internetowa przekona testy i spełni wymogi stosowane przy publikacji, może przejść do etapu wdrożenia i uruchomienia. To jednak nie jest końcem, lecz początkiem dalszej eksploatacji i działania witryny.
Rozwinięcie w środowisku produkcyjnym
Rozwój oznacza przenoszenie gotowych plików witryny internetowej, bazy danych oraz wszystkich konfiguracji na publiczny serwer (w środowisku produkcyjnym). Proces ten zwykle składa się z następujących kroków: zakupu nazwy domeny i hostingu (lub chmurowego serwera, np. AWS, Alibaba Cloud), konfiguracji rozwiązania DNS oraz ustawienia środowiska serwera (np. serwera internetowego). Nginx/ApacheUsługi baz danych, upload plików z witryny internetowej, importowanie danych do bazy. W procesach rozwoju współczesnych często używane są narzędzia typu CI/CD (Continuous Integration/Continuous Deployment). GitHub Actions 或 Jenkins Proces automatycznego wdrożenia. Zanim dokona się ostatecznej zmiany, zaleca się najpierw przeprowadzić finalną weryfikację na tymczasowym adresie internetowym.
Polecamy lekturę. Opanowanie Tailwind CSS: od podstaw po efektywną rozработkę projektów praktycznych。
Złożenie wniosków do wyszukiwarki internetowej oraz podstawowe działania związane z optymalizacją witryny
Po uruchomieniu witryny konieczne jest informowanie wyszukiwarki o jej istnieniu. Do tego służą narzędzia takie jak Google Search Console oraz platforma Baidu Search Resources. Za pomocą tych narzędzi można złożyć mapę witryny (site map) do wyszukiwarki. sitemap.xmlMoże pomóc wyszukiwarkom w szybszym odnalezieniu i indeksowaniu stron. Dodatkowo zapewnia… robots.txt Konfiguracja pliku jest poprawna – wskazuje wyszukiwarkom, które elementy treści mogą zostać pobrane. Na początku działania witryny należy sprawdzić, czy wszystkie strony mają poprawnie wypełnione tagi opisowe (title tags).<title>) oraz metadyskrypcję (<meta name="description">Wszystkie są unikalne i dokładnie opisują daną rzecz.
Monitorowanie, konserwacja oraz ciągłe aktualizacje
Po uruchomieniu witryny konieczne jest ciągłe monitorowanie jej stanu działania. Do monitorowania dostępności witryny („uptime”) oraz szybkości jej ładowania można używać specjalnych narzędzi, a także ustawić analizę logów w celu wykrywania błędów. Regularne tworzenie kopii bezpieczeństwa plików witryny i bazy danych to kluczowy element bezpieczeństwa. Ponadto treść witryny musi być stale aktualizowana – publikowanie nowych artykułów na blogu, aktualizacja informacji o produktach czy organizacja eventów może przyciągnąć użytkowników i pomóc w poprawieniu pozycji witryny w wynikach wyszukiwarki. Dodatkowo należy regularnie aktualizować oprogramowanie CMS, tematy, dodatki oraz frameworky używane do budowy witryny, aby naprawić potencjalne bezpieczeństwowe problemy i uzyskać nowe funkcje.
Podsumowanie.
Stworzenie wysokiej wydajności witryny internetowej od zera to proces złożony, wymagający ścisłego przestrzegania całościowego łańcza od planowania, projektowania, rozwoju po wdrożenie i utrzymanie. Każdy etap stanowi element łączący poprzednie i następne, i nie może być pominięty. Jasne planowanie stanowi drogówkę do realizacji celów, doskonałe projektowanie zapewnia atrakcyjność witryny, solidny rozwój umożliwia jej funkcjonowanie, a regularne utrzymanie gwarantuje jej długoterminową stabilność i ciągłe generowanie wartości. Doskonałe opanowanie i stosowanie tego procesu pozwala nie tylko stworzyć witrynę odpowiadającą wymaganiom biznesu, ale także ułożyć solidne fundamenty dla jej długoterminowego, bezproblemowego działania.
FAQ – najczęściej zadawane pytania.
Czy konieczne jest od zera pisanie kodu przy budowaniu witryny internetowej typu ###?
Nie koniecznie. W zależności od wymagań projektu i umiejętności zespołu można wybrać różny punkt startu. W przypadku wielu firmowych stron internetowych, blogów lub stron e-handlu często używa się doświadczonych systemów zarządzania treścią (CMS). WordPress、Shopify 或 Wix To bardziej efektywny wybór. Dostępne są liczne tematy i dodatki, które można dostosować, by zaspokoić większość potrzeb, bez konieczności zaawansowanego programowania. W przypadku aplikacji wymagających wysokiej personalizacji, złożonych interakcji lub specjalnych wymagań pod względem wydajności, lepszym rozwiązaniem będzie rozwój od zera lub użycie popularnych frameworków.
Czy responsywny design jest obowiązkowym wymogiem dla współczesnych stron internetowych?
Tak, projektowanie responsywne stało się standardowym wymogiem i najlepszą praktyką w budowaniu stron internetowych w czasach współczesnych. Ponieważ udział ruchu na urządzeniach mobilnych stale przewyższa udział ruchu na komputerach stacjonarnych, istotne jest, aby witryna zapewniała dobrą jakość użytkownika na wszystkich rozmiarach ekranów. To nie tylko wymóg użytkownika, ale także ważny element algoritmów sortowania wyników w wyszukiwarkach internetowych, np. Google. Zastosowanie projektowania responsywnego jest bardziej rentowne pod względem kosztów i łatwiejsze w utrzymaniu niż tworzenie osobnej wersji witryny dla urządzeń mobilnych.
Jak ocenić, czy wydajność witryny internetowej spełnia wymagania, zanim zostanie uruchomiona?
Można użyć szeregu bezpłatnych i profesjonalnych narzędzi online do przeprowadzania ocen ilościowych. Narzędzie Lighthouse od Google (włączone do narzędzi developerskich Chrome) umożliwia uzyskanie pełnego sprawozdania o wydajności witryny, dostępności dla osób niepełnosprawnych, stosowaniu najlepszych praktyk oraz oceny i sugestii dotyczących SEO. PageSpeed Insights umożliwia analizę wydajności witryny na urządzeniach mobilnych i stacjonarnych. Ponadto konieczne są ręczne testy w rzeczywistych warunkach, aby sprawdzić, czy kluczowe procesy użytkownika (np. przeglądanie produktów, dodawanie do koszyka, dokonanie płatności) przebiegają bez problemów, a także sprawdzić szybkość ładowania witryny w różnych warunkach sieci.
Po ukończeniu budowy witryny internetowej, jak często konieczne jest jej aktualizowanie i konserwacja?
Konserwacja i aktualizacje powinny być procesem ciągłym. Częstotliwość aktualizacji treści zależy od typu witryny internetowej: na przykład witryny informacyjne lub blogi mogą wymagać aktualizacji co dzień lub co tydzień, natomiast witryny prezentujące produkty firmowe mogą wymagać aktualizacji co miesiąc lub co kwartał. Co do technicznej konserwacji, konieczne jest regularne (np. co tydzień lub co miesiąc) sprawdzanie i aktualizowanie oprogramowania CMS, dodatków, tematów, a także aktualizacji patchów bezpieczeństwa w operacyjnym systemie serwera i innych programach. Zaleca się przeprowadzać pełne skanowania bezpieczeństwa oraz tworzenie kopii bezpiecznych danych co najmniej raz na miesiąc. Monitorowanie wydajności i analiza danych powinny być prowadzone w sposób ciągły, aby w czasie wykrywać problemy i poprawiać jakość korzystania z witryny.
Następny krok, co dalej?
Dalsze lektury i praktyczna wiedza.
Poniższe treści są powiązane z tematem tego artykułu i warto je przeczytać. Zwykle lepiej zacząć od artykułu, który najbardziej odpowiada aktualnemu problemowi, a potem stopniowo przechodzić do tematów pokrewnych.
- 5 kluczowych kroków: jak zarejestrować i skonfigurować swoją pierwszą domenę internetową od zera
- Przewodnik po tematach WordPress: od wyboru do dokładnej personalizacji
- Jak wybrać i dostosować temat WordPress odpowiedni dla twojego witryny internetowej: od początków do poziomu eksperta
- Światowy przewodnik po VPS-ach: jak stworzyć własną stronę internetową i serwer od zera
- Jak wybrać i dostosować temat dla swojego WordPressa: pełny przewodnik od początków do zaawansowania